Q: Is 85,101,335 a Composite Number?

 A: Yes, 85,101,335 is a composite number.

Why is 85,101,335 a composite number?

A composite number is a number that can be divided evenly by more numbers than 1 and itself. It is the opposite of a prime number.

The number 85,101,335 can be evenly divided by 1 5 11 55 151 755 1,661 8,305 10,247 51,235 112,717 563,585 1,547,297 7,736,485 17,020,267 and 85,101,335, with no remainder.

Since 85,101,335 cannot be divided by just 1 and 85,101,335, it is a composite number.
